From 16d4d14578035377d518e91ee2165d7e609f8e2a Mon Sep 17 00:00:00 2001 From: Chaitanya Sai Meka Date: Tue, 11 Nov 2025 16:31:32 +0530 Subject: [PATCH] docs: clarify BeforeValidator is available only in Pydantic v2 --- docs/en/docs/tutorial/query-params-str-validations.md | 2 ++ 1 file changed, 2 insertions(+) diff --git a/docs/en/docs/tutorial/query-params-str-validations.md b/docs/en/docs/tutorial/query-params-str-validations.md index f473958de..f64b980c4 100644 --- a/docs/en/docs/tutorial/query-params-str-validations.md +++ b/docs/en/docs/tutorial/query-params-str-validations.md @@ -278,6 +278,8 @@ If you want to accept special values (like `"None"` or an empty string) and inte {* ../../docs_src/query_params_str_validations/tutorial006d_an_py310.py hl[9,11] *} +> **Note**: This example uses `BeforeValidator`, which is only available in **Pydantic v2**. + ## Query parameter list / multiple values { #query-parameter-list-multiple-values } When you define a query parameter explicitly with `Query` you can also declare it to receive a list of values, or said in another way, to receive multiple values.